Description

Lagunitas One Hitter Series 4Pk is a rotating 4-pack of limited-release, small-batch experimental beers from Lagunitas Brewing Company in Petaluma, California, with ABV varying by release. Each edition showcases a different style brewed in the brewery's smallest fermenters, making every installment a one-time exploration of hops, malt, and creative ambition.

Quick Facts: ABV: Varies by release (typically 7–8%)  |  Origin: Petaluma, California, USA  |  Style: Rotating experimental series  |  Brewery: Lagunitas Brewing Company

Production & Heritage

Lagunitas Brewing Company was founded in 1993 in Lagunitas, California, before relocating to Petaluma, and is now part of the Heineken International family. The One Hitter Series represents the brewery's experimental side—each batch is brewed in their smallest fermenters as a way to test new recipes, ingredients, and stylistic ideas that fall outside the core lineup. Past releases have included imperial stouts, hazy IPAs, barrel-aged ales, and fruit-forward lagers, each reflecting a different corner of the brewing team's imagination.

Tasting Notes

Because the One Hitter Series rotates styles with each release, specific tasting notes vary. The following reflects common flavor profiles reported across multiple editions:

Aroma: Many releases lead with citrus and tropical fruit—mango, dried pineapple, and mandarin orange are frequently noted. Light pine and resinous hop character often emerge underneath.

Taste: The palate typically delivers bold, hop-forward fruit notes—apricot marmalade, peaches, and passion fruit have appeared in IPA-leaning editions. Malt-focused releases like Tuberfest lean into a zing-y, bready fest beer profile with layered sweetness. Barrel-aged variants bring balanced oak and vanilla tones.

Finish: Most editions finish with moderate bitterness and lingering fruit or malt complexity. The small-batch nature tends to produce beers with more concentrated flavor and a clean, decisive close.

How to Drink One Hitter Series

Pour into a tulip glass or shaker pint to capture the full aromatic range of each release; these beers benefit from slightly cool rather than ice-cold temperatures. Hop-forward editions work well in a Beermosa, substituting for champagne alongside fresh orange juice. Malt-driven releases pair naturally in a Beer Float with vanilla ice cream. Any edition with citrus or tropical notes can anchor a Michelada, mixed with lime, hot sauce, and Worcestershire for a savory contrast.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does One Hitter Series taste like? The flavor profile changes with every release, but editions commonly feature bold fruit-forward hops, citrus, tropical notes, and balanced malt sweetness, with ABVs typically ranging between 7% and 8%.

How does One Hitter Series compare to Lagunitas IPA? Lagunitas IPA is a consistent, year-round flagship at 6.2% ABV with a defined hop profile, while the One Hitter Series rotates styles and recipes with each limited batch, often at higher ABVs and with more adventurous ingredients.

Is One Hitter Series good for craft beer beginners? Because styles rotate and ABVs tend to run in the 7–8% range, this series is better suited to experienced craft beer drinkers comfortable with bolder, more experimental flavors.

Where is One Hitter Series made? The One Hitter Series is brewed by Lagunitas Brewing Company at their facility in Petaluma, California, using their smallest fermenters for small-batch production.

What foods pair well with One Hitter Series? Hop-forward releases pair well with spicy Thai or Mexican dishes that match citrus and tropical notes. Malt-driven editions complement grilled bratwurst, pretzels, or smoked cheddar. Barrel-aged variants stand up to rich desserts like chocolate torte or crème brûlée.

What sizes does One Hitter Series come in? The standard retail format is a 4-pack; individual can or bottle sizes vary by release but are typically 12 oz.

Why One Hitter Series?

What separates the One Hitter Series from the rest of the Lagunitas portfolio is its intentional impermanence—each release is brewed once in the brewery's smallest fermenters and then retired. That small-batch approach gives the brewing team room to experiment with ingredients and styles that would never scale to flagship production. For drinkers, it means every 4-pack is a snapshot of a moment in Lagunitas' creative process. In a market flooded with rotating hazy IPAs, the One Hitter Series stands out by refusing to commit to a single style, offering everything from imperial stouts to fruit-forward lagers under one unpredictable banner.
